Ancient Village or Settlement in Ukraine
Torchesk was a town established by the Turkic tribe of Torks under the Kyivan Rus'. It was ruined by the Cumans in 1093 and rebuilt in the 12th century, to be ruined again in the 13th century by the Mongols. The hillfort survived from the Rus' period.
